In case you weren't already aware, it rained yesterday in Columbia. Actually, it was a downpour. Five Points flooded. Thomas Cooper's fifth-floor computer lab flooded. The basement of the business building flooded. Vehicles were stuck. Some cars floated.

This entire week has focused on only one issue: football tickets. Students have fought through loyalty points and Internet crashes, with little hope that they would get to see their first (or second, or 10th, or 30th) Carolina game. We know how much this weekend will mean for many students: tailgating on the fairgrounds; cheering with friends in Williams-Brice Stadium; (hopefully) walking home with the electrifying feeling of victory. Every student should experience this at least once, and, after a week of pressure, USC is making that experience an opportunity for more of us.
